Arsenic trioxide is the key merchandise of arsenic smelters. This oxide has direct purposes in business—e.g., as a glass decolorizing agent. Other commercially useful organic and inorganic arsenic derivatives are geared up from it.
Within the processing of As2O3 the oxide is Usually lowered withcarbon: 2As2O3+3C?→As4+3CO2 The response is endothermic and it is carried out at 500–800℃.The elemental arsenic sublimes which is condensed out from the reaction gasoline by cooling.

The speed of dissolution is extremely lower, and a number of other months are needed to attain equilibrium. The speed of dissolution from the amor phous, glassy variety is better than that of claudetite. Arsenic trioxide is a bit soluble in glycerol.
o-Arsenous acid and m-arsenous acid could kind as merchandise in the hydrolysis of As4O6. By analogy With all the phosphorus compound, the meta acid could be envisioned to get polymeric.
Nonetheless, the arsenic–oxygen–arsenic bond is thought to have Intense hydrolytic instability. Consequently, read more the monomeric ortho sort could well be envisioned for being the predominant species.

Thermal decomposition of your pentoxide converts it for the trioxide with concurrent lack of oxygen. The pentoxide, in contrast Along with the trioxide, is quite soluble in drinking water; 630 g of arsenic pentoxide dissolve in 100 g of water.

The sulfides are commonly secure in air at home temperature, but realgar is extremely vulnerable to assault by oxygen beneath illumination. At increased temperatures, the sulfides of arsenic react with oxygen.
Arsenolite is produced up of As4O6 molecules through which 4 arsenic atoms occupy the corners of a tetrahedron, with Each and every set of arsenic atoms joined by a bridging oxygen atom.

An exceptionally substantial quantity of arsenic compounds that include one or more arsenic–carbon bonds are already synthesized. The large range of compounds is designed achievable because of the assets on the arsenic atom to bond from just one to 5 organic groups, aromatic or aliphatic.
